2008 E93 M3 DCT
I have been chasing this problem with no avail. The car starts up and will occasionally misfire on idle. Once driving the car is perfectly fine under any type of load(meaning on the gas). As soon as I take my foot of the gas the car stalls out completely no matter the speed. Once I get stopped I can turn the ignition off completely and restart the car and it runs the same till it stalls again. Using INPA and ISTA I have found a few things. -only modification is catless full exhaust dual resonated from valve Tronic Section Dme 2b6b 2b57 2b6a 2b6e 2b6d 2b68 2b6c 2b69 2b67 2789 278a 2739 27c5 Section EGS 5a73-paddle shifter voltage fault Section ASK A1A3 Section FZD A670 Section MOSTGW E18D E18F Battery is brand new Coils and spark plugs brand new If you have any ideas please help!! |
